November 21, 2013 – “The brilliance of Honda engineering shines once again in the form of the 2014 CTX700N. This is a bike specifically engineered to make motorcycling more approachable, affordable and fun than ever before.”

Thanks to a low seat height of only 28.3 inches, riders can quickly get acclimated to life in the saddle. Honda’s acclaimed automatic Dual Clutch Transmission (DCT) provides either a fully automatic mode or the option of more active gear selection via paddle-shift type buttons on the handlebar, and the DCT version also comes with an Antilock Braking System (ABS).

The 670cc parallel-twin engine features cylinders canted 62 degrees forward for enhanced weight distribution and a lower center of gravity for ease of handling.

This smooth-running fuel-injected engine pumps out loads of low-end and midrange torque to simplify launching from stops even with the optional six-speed manual gearbox, and there’s enough power on tap for wherever the road may lead.

Beneath the fuel tank cover there’s a handy glove box area, and the fuel is carried below. All in all, the CTX700N is an amazingly affordable, fun, friendly and comfortable bike that is perfect for everyday rides, weekend trips, two-up exploring or just about anything else you can dream up.

Features & Benefits

Sophisticated liquid-cooled SOHC eight-valve 670cc parallel-twin engine pumps out abundant torque in the low-end and midrange for easily accessible power.

An impressively broad torque curve gives the CTX700N a linear and smooth power delivery.

A relatively long engine stroke (80.0mm combined with a 73.0mm bore) and a high-inertia crankshaft are design elements that add to the CTX700N’s extremely tractable power characteristics.

The 62-degree forward lean given to the cylinder assembly facilitates near-vertical mounting of the single 36mm throttle body for superior intake port positioning and shaping. In addition, special shaping to the combustion chambers further enhance engine combustion efficiency for clean burning and optimal power production.

An engine balancer shaft quells vibration for smooth, comfortable operation, and rubber-mounted footrests add to rider comfort.

Programmed Fuel Injection (PGM-FI) continuously monitors numerous variables to ensure the correct fuel mixture for existing riding and atmospheric conditions, thereby delivering optimal performance and remarkably crisp throttle response over a wide range of operating conditions.

Two Model Options

  • CTX700ND with DCT/ABS features a second-generation automatic six-speed Honda Dual Clutch Transmission that uses two hydraulically controlled clutches to deliver quick and smooth gear changes in a choice of three modes: Manual (MT), which allows the rider to shift gears using buttons, and two automatic (AT) modes: S for sport riding and D for everyday use. The DCT model also features an Antilock Braking System (ABS) to provide full antilock functionality for secure braking action.
  • CTX700N features a manual six-speed transmission.

Honda CTX700N and CTX700ND Features

  • Low seat height, along with the new Honda parallel-twin engine design, creates a very low center of gravity, making the CTX700N feel remarkably nimble and fun to ride.
  • Fuel capacity of 3.27 gallons and great fuel efficiency give the CTX700N a long cruising range.
  • A rigid and compact diamond-shape steel frame, low center of gravity and plush suspension help make the CTX700N responsive, agile and enjoyable to ride all day.
  • Stout 41mm front fork provides 4.2 inches of travel, while the Pro-Link® rear suspension system delivers 4.3 inches of wheel travel.
  • A remarkably low seat height of 28.3 inches helps instill rider confidence.
  • Open, roomy ergonomics position the rider in a well-balanced seating position for all-day comfort and fun.

2014 Honda CTX700N and CTX700ND Specifications

  • Models: CTX700N (Manual Transmission) or CTX700ND (Automatic Dual Clutch Transmission and ABS).
  • Engine Type: 670cc liquid-cooled parallel-twin.
  • Bore and Stroke: 73.0 mm x 80.0 mm.
  • Compression ratio: 10.7:1
  • Valve Train: SOHC; four valves per cylinder.
  • Induction: PGM-FI with 36mm throttle body.
  • Ignition: Digital transistorized with electronic advance.
  • Transmission: Six-speed (CTX700N) / Automatic DCT six-speed (CTX700ND).
  • Final Drive: Chain.
  • Suspension: Front: 41mm fork; 4.2 inches travel. Rear: Pro-Link single shock; 4.3 inches travel.
  • Brakes: Front: Single 320mm disc with two-piston caliper. Rear: Single 240mm disc with single-piston caliper. Optional ABS available with DCT.
  • Tires: Front: 120/70-17. Rear: 160/60-17.
  • Wheelbase: 60.2 inches.
  • Rake (Caster angle): 27.7°
  • Trail: 114.0 mm (4.4 inches).
  • Seat Height: 28.3 inches .
  • Fuel Capacity: 3.27 gallons.
  • Estimated Fuel Economy: 64 MPG (CTX700N) / 61 MPG (CTX700ND)
  • Colors: CTX700N: Candy Red, Black. CTX700ND: Black.
  • Curb Weight: 478 pounds (CTX700N) or 500 pounds (CTX700ND). Includes all standard equipment, required fluids and full tank of fuel, ready to ride.
